WHAT WILL YOU GET FROM A BASIC LOFT CONVERSION IN YOUR UPTON HOME?

In general, a basic loft conversion will consist of a stairway to access the loft conversion and a single bedroom with one or two Velux windows; that's pretty much it. But there's more to a loft conversion than putting down some flooring and plasterboarding the walls:) Unless it is in a conservation district or a listed structure, a basic loft conversion with only Velux windows will not require Planning Permission. A basic loft conversion must still adhere to current building requirements and will necessitate a Building Warrant, the major areas being:

• Fire

• Structural

• Insulation

• Stairs

• Noise

HOW TO ENSURE FIRE SAFETY FOR A LOFT CONVERSION IN UPTON?

It is critical that in the case of a fire, you and your family have a safe evacuation route from your loft. The building standards have adopted a stricter position on this....and rightly so if it may save lives. If the loft conversion is in a bungalow, fire standards are less stringent since it is assumed that you may evacuate the building by a window in the case of a fire at this height; if it is in a two-story house, things get a little more interesting. The amount of fire protection necessary for a loft conversion in a two-story house is significantly increased since it is quite unlikely that you would survive leaving by a window at this height, it's just not possible. The stair enclosure must provide 30 minutes of fire protection, all doors must be fire rated with intumescent seals, and the existing upper story ceilings must either have an extra layer of plasterboard or be covered with an authorized intumescent paint.

IS IT POSSIBLE TO HAVE A ROOM IN ROOF TRUSSES?

Because most Loft or Attic rooms are not intended to be "Habitable areas," they will necessarily need some structural adjustments. Most contemporary roof trusses are only intended to hold the roof up! Some roof trusses (often in bungalows) have been constructed as attic trusses; they have been engineered with a future loft conversion in mind and will require minimal if any, structural adjustments. With varied degrees of structural alteration, most lofts can be transformed. If you have a very restricted budget and your Loft requires extensive structural improvements, the structural work is likely to consume the majority of your cash. A staircase and Velux windows will also be necessary, as well as structural work.

WHAT ARE THE INSULATION STANDARDS FOR A LOFT CONVERSION IN UPTON?

The degree of insulation required for a loft conversion (to fulfill minimal requirements) is the same whether the loft conversion is simple or high-end. In comparison to a property built after 1983, the insulation levels required for the loft conversion will be higher if the building was built before 1983. (but not by much). Typical sloped roof construction will be as follows:

• Kingspan 100mm insulation between the rafters

• Over the rafters, a 25mm Kingspan is used.

• Service gap of 30mm

• Finish: 12.5mm plasterboard

HOW MUCH DOES A LOFT CONVERSION COST IN Upton?

The average cost of a Loft Conversion in Upton is between £40,000 to £90,000. (in 2022) The most common type of Loft Conversion is the dormer as it adds the most space and best light to your property. A loft conversion will not only give you extra space but also enhance your living space on your property. A loft conversion price depends on many factors such as type of the conversion, type of the roof you have, type of the lighting you want in the loft, the type of windows required, the size of the project, fixtures and fittings, nature of the exterior, client's personal requirements and the site's location.
